Barbados - Re-Export of Glass Fibres, Glass Wool and Articles Thereof
Since 2014, Barbados Re-Export of Glass Fibres, Glass Wool and Articles Thereof jumped by 67.5% year on year. With $8,175.9 in 2019, the country was ranked number 18 among other countries in Re-Export of Glass Fibres, Glass Wool and Articles Thereof. Barbados is overtaken by Fiji, which was number 17 at $8,993.13 and is followed by Georgia at $7,178.13. United States topped the ranking with $24,878,803.56 in 2019, an increase of 4.4% versus 2018. United Arab Emirates, Canada and Oman resp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belize recorded the best 5 years average growth at +349.3% per year, while Sri Lanka witnessed the worst performance at -45.2% per year.
